Tennessee HS Hoops Gets Shot Clock

from Memphis News Today | 2 Min News | The Daily News Now!

Tennessee high school basketball is about to get a shot clock starting in 2029-30, forcing teams to act fast with just 35 seconds to shoot. While supporters say it’ll elevate the game’s strategy and bring it in line with national standards, schools face steep costs—up to $10,000 per clock—and a shortage of trained officials to operate them. Coaches are weighing tough budget choices, hoping parents or teachers will step in, while others plan to hire extra staff. With four years to prepare and some schools already testing shot clocks in non-league games, this change could reshape the state’s hoops scene—bringing both promise and pressure.
